The Kremlin hosted talks between Russian President Vladimir Putin and Special Envoy of the US President Steven Witkoff. This was reported by the press service of the head of state
"The Kremlin hosted a meeting between the President of Russia and the Special Envoy of the President of the United States of America, Steven Witkoff," the statement said.
At the moment, no other details are reported.
According to TASS, Putin and Witkoff began the meeting with a brief exchange of greetings in English.
"How are you, Mr. President?" asked Witkoff, entering the office.
"Great, thanks! And how are you doing?" — Putin replied and extended his palm to the guest for a handshake.
"I am very glad to see you!" added the special envoy of the American president.
After that, he and Putin went to the table for a conversation.
On the Russian side, Presidential Aide Yuri Ushakov and CEO of RDIF, Special Presidential Representative for Investment and economic Cooperation with foreign countries Kirill Dmitriev took part in the negotiations.
